My name is Corey . I am a 21 yr old and I am looking for a way out. I have struggled with successful business ideas for the past ten years. Born in NY raised in FL, I have always had a drive to sell. Initially I started selling any of my old toys to build capital to reinvest. This worked great until I reached a plateau where I would only break even or it was not time effective. After I figured this would be the end I started brainstorming more ideas for possible success. I was coming up to 16 years old and I was ready to drive and start the "real world". So after days of contemplating and searching for solutions for consumers my light bulb lit up. Wearable paracord bottle openers. 2 months later of product development and prototypes the BOTTLEBAND was ready to see light. After a soft launch I received a lot of great feedback although there was some criticism. Instead of taking the criticism seriously and building upon it, I ignored it and added it to the list of failed businesses. Meanwhile, during this time I had graduated early from high-school, started full time college to complete my AA and I was working 2 jobs. My days went as followed
6:30am wake up
7:15am-11:30 carbonfiber fabric pipe repair
12:00-3:30 3 classes
4:00-10:00 Courier for medical lab
11:00-12:30 finish any loose ends with school.
Working two jobs at the age of sixteen was overwhelming not from the physical labor but from the amount of money.
I was making ~$500 a week which is substantial relative to my age. So what does a youngin do with all that money? blow it senseless.
I managed to limit myself and create two online savings account via Barclays and Ally bank
That went on until I had saved up just short of $6,000. Well what does that call for? Europe trip
I spent 32 days exploring eastern Europe starting in Amsterdam through as south as capri and as west as Barcelona. After coming back from this trip I realized I need to create enough constant sales to live this lifestyle.
